Dustin Lee Dinwiddie
On 02/22/2022 Dustin Lee Dinwiddie unexpectedly passed away, Dustin was Born 04/22/1983 (39yrs) in Yuma, AZ to his parents Lydia Dinwiddie & Donald Dinwiddie. Dustin spent his youth attending grade school in Somerton AZ and Yuma AZ he was a high school graduate of Cibola High School. Dustin was a member of the Cibola marching band, Civil Air Patrol, and the Arizona Western College jazz band.
Dustin discovered his true calling in life at an early age, being a Firefighter, and later obtaining his Paramedic certification and working for almost all the surrounding fire departments in Yuma County, Somerton/Cocopah Fire Department, Rural Metro Fire Department, Tri-Valley Fire Department and Yuma Proving Grounds Fire Department. Dustin enjoyed every aspect of the job, but he excelled greatly when it came to teaching. Dustin would constantly want to discuss various aspects of the job such as hazardous material, rope rescue, fire ground tactics, and many more topics daily. He would spend his free time enjoying hobbies such as hunting, camping, shooting, reloading, fishing, kayaking, and cooking outside on his smoker. Dustin spent nearly 20 years in the fire service and multiple departments and even when his body would no longer allow him to continue, he strived to educate future firefighters. Dustin spent time in Kingman AZ at Lee Williams high school where he was hired to teach high school students a fire-based curriculum. Dustin also spent time in Gonzalez Louisiana where he was hired to instruct a hazardous materials technician course. His most recent endeavor was refreshing his paramedic certification to return to the job he loved. Dustin was in the hiring process for AMR as a paramedic in Las Vegas NV, at the time of his passing.
Dustin Lee Dinwiddie is survived by his son, Hayden Lee Dinwiddie, daughter, Hailey Faith Dinwiddie. His parents Lydia Dinwiddie & Donald Dinwiddie. And his brother Matthew Dinwiddie.
